Output d5f53da4edffcb32ed04a22a4e2cfb60b0986d1cde7bfd2b907849148de0504d:1

value
326489046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5bd65556a708572a88099b6ef6919656777014d OP_EQUAL
address
3JFy7icmx47aVh6nDPs9ZuDqjAfvNthzMU
transaction
d5f53da4edffcb32ed04a22a4e2cfb60b0986d1cde7bfd2b907849148de0504d
confirmations
383607
spent
true